Open Vector Editor Electron
A simple file based genbank/fasta file viewer and editor. Works with mac/windows/linux.
Some of the top features or benefits of Open Vector Editor Electron are: Open Source, Cross-Platform, User-Friendly Interface, and Bioinformatics Tool. You can visit the info page to learn more.
